1 SAMUEL CHAPTER 19



Saul purposeth to kill David; Jonathan discloseth it; speaketh in his behalf to Saul, who sweareth not to kill him; he returneth to court, 1Sa_19:1-7. By reason of his success in a new war, Saul again seeketh to kill him; Michal acquainteth him with it; he flieth; she deceiveth her father, 1Sa_19:8-17. David cometh to Samuel at Ramah; Saul sendeth messengers twice to apprehend him; they both prophesy, 1Sa_19:18-21. He goeth himself thither, and prophesieth likewise, 1Sa_19:22-24.



Saul spake to Jonathan; whom, though lately engaged in a league of friendship with David, he thought to oblige to it by sense of his own interest, as being the next heir of the crown, and likely to suffer most by David’s advancement. And to all his servants: what before he secretly designed, now he openly and impudently avowed.
